Environmental protection, culture, talent, skills and youth all marked our activities in July!

Emphasizing that #OurPlanetisOurFuture, we talked about the challenge of light pollution and star-gazed together during our event “What is a city without stars?” Our Ecopedia is richer with two new editions on the occasion of World Moon Day and interesting advice on sustainable gardening habits. Together with the youngest of participants, we organized a sustainable and healthy small kitchen and learned about healthy habits and sustainable nutrition.

Celebrating the potential of culture to bring out the potential of young people, while human rights, together with Mirko Ilić and the Academy of Fine Arts in Trebinje, we organised a presentation of the international traveling exhibition Tolerance in Trebinje. As part of #EuropeForCulture, Trebinje became part of a community of more than 150 cities where the exhibition has been organised.

The best way to network young people and exchange experiences is to provide opportunities for open discussion, transfer of skills and dissemination of new, interesting information. As part of our Skill Fusion event, under the auspices of #EUforYouth and European Year of Skills, we enabled young people to transfer skills and connect with like-minded people.
